2.Waking Up
Alhamdu lillahil-ladhi ahyaana ba'da ma amaatana wa ilaihin nushur.

Praise is to Allah Who bring us lifes after He has brought us death and unto Him is the return. [Abu Dawud 4/264, Ahmad 2/389]



3.Getting Dressed

Alhamdu lillahil-ladhi kasaani hadha (aththauba) wa razaqaneehi min ghairi haulim-minni wa la quwwatin.

Praise is to Allah who has clothed me with this (garment) and provided it for me, though I was powerless myself and incapable. [Bukhari, Muslim, Dawud, Ibn Majah, At-Tirmidhi]



4.Getting Undressed

Bismillah.

By/In the Name of Allah. [At-Tirmidhi 2/505]



5.Before Eating
Bismillah.

By/In the Name of Allah. [Ibn Majah 1/557, see also An-Nawawi, Kitabul Adhkar 4/342]


If you forgot to say the above before eating, then say the following as soon as you remember:

Bismilaahi 'awwalihi wa aakhirihi.

In the Name of Allah, over the beginning of it and the end of it.

[Recorded by al-Tirmidhi, According to al-Hilaali, this hadith is sahih due to its supporting evidence. See al-Hilaali, vo. 2, pp. 580-581]



6.After Sneezing


The muslim who sneezed should immediately say:

Alhamdulillah

All praises and thanks are (due) to Allah.


The muslim who hears a sneezer say "Alhamdulillah" should then say:

Yar hamu-kAllah

May Allah have mercy upon you.


The original sneezer may then say:

Yahdeekumu-llaahu wa yuslihu baalakum.

May Allah guide you and set your affairs in order. [Bukhari 7/125]


When a disbeliever sneezes, the Muslim says:

Yahdeekumu-llaahu wa yuslihu baalakum.

May Allah guide you and set your affairs in order. [At-Tirmidhi 5/82, Ahmad 4/400, Dawud 4/308]



7.Before Entering the Toilet
[Bismillahi] Allahumma inna 'audhu bika minal khubthi wal khabaa'ith.

[By the Name of Allah]. Oh Allah, I seek protection in You from unclean spirits, male and female. [Abu Dawud 4/264, Ahmad 2/389]



8.After Leaving the Toilet

Ghufraanak(a).

I seek Your forgiveness.


Hadith - Al-Tirmidhi, Narrated 'Aisha, r.a.

When Allah's Apostle (peace be upon him) came out from the privy, he said: (I seek) forgiveness from Thee. [Transmitted by Tirmidhi, Ibn Majah and Darimi]


9.Before Sleeping

Bismika Rabbi wada'tu janbi, wa bika arfa'uhu, fa'in amsakta nafsi farhamha, wa in arsaltaha fahfazha, bima tahfazu bihi 'ibaadakas saaliheen.

With Your Name my Lord, I lay myself down; and with Your Name I rise. And if my soul You take, have mercy on it, and if You send it back then preserve it as you preserve Your righteous slaves. [Bukhari 11/126, Muslim 4/2083]


Bismika Allahuma amootu wa ahya.

In Your Name, Oh Allah, I die and I live. [Dying and living are metaphors for sleep and wakefulness, Allahu Alam. See Qur'an 2:258, 3:156, 7:158, Al-Asqalani, Fath Al-Bari 11/113, Muslim 4/2083]



Brief Alertness During Sleep (i.e. stirring in the bed, turning over in the bed)

La ilaha illallahul Wahidul Qahharu, Rabbus samaawaati wal ardi wa ma bainahumal Azeezul Ghaffaru.

There is no deity but Allah, the One, the Victorious, Lord of the heavens and the earth and all that is between them, the All-Mighty, the All-Forgiving. [Al-Hakim, An-Nasa'i, see also Al-Albani]



10.Waking Up from a Bad Dream

A'udhu bikalimaatil lahit taammaati min ghadabihi wa 'iqaabihi, wa sharri ibaadihi, wa min hamazatish shayaateeni wa an yahdurun.

I seek refuge in the Perfect Word of Allah from His anger and His punishment, from the evil of His slaves and from the taunts of jinn and from their presence. [Abu Dawud 4/12. See also Al-Albani]



11.Upon Entering the Marketplace

laa 'ilaaha 'illa-llaahu wahdahu laa shareeka lahu lahu-lmulku wa lahu-l-hamdu yuhyee wa yumeetu wa huwa hayyun laa yamootu biyadihi-l-khairu wa huwa 'ala kulli shai 'in qadeer.

There is none worthy of worship except Allah, alone, without any partner with Him. For Him is the Dominion and to Him is the praise. He gives life and He brings about death; He is living and does not die. In His hand is all good and He has power over all things. [Recorded by al-Tirmidhi. According to al-Albani, this hadith is hasan. See al-Albani, Sahih al-Jaami, vol. 2, p. 1070]



12.When Someone Does a Good Deed for Another
jazaaku-llaahu khairan

May Allah reward you well.

[Recorded by Abu Dawood and al-Tirmidhi. According to al-Albani, this hadith is sahih. See al-Albani, Sahih al-Jaami, vol. 2, p. 1089]



13.Calamity

Inna lillahi wa inna ilaihi raji'un

We belong to Allah and to Him we shall return.

The Prophet as saying, "If any Muslim man or woman suffers a calamity and keeps it in his memory, even if it happened a long time ago, saying each time it is remembered, 'We belong to Allah and to Him do we return,' Allah, who is Blessed and Exalted will give a fresh reward each time it is said, equivalent to the reward when it happened." [Tirmidhi: Ahmad and Bayhaqi, in Shu'ab al-Iman, transmitted it.]



14.Meeting an Adversary or Powerful Ruler or Fearing a People
Allahumma inna naj'aluka fee nuhoorihim wa na'udhu bika min shuroorihim.

Oh Allah, we ask you to restrain them by their necks and we seek refuge in you from their evil. [Dawud 2/89, Al-Hakim 2/142]


Allahumma Anta adudi, wa Anta naseeri, bika ajoolu, wa bika asoolu, wa bika oqaatilu.

Oh Allah, You are my strength and You are my victory. For Your sake I go forth and for Your sake I stand firm and for Your sake I fight. [Dawud 3/42, At-Tirmidhi 5/572]



15.When Breaking the fast

dhahaba-DHama 'u wabtallati-l-'urooqu wa thabata-l-ajru 'insha 'allaah.

The thirst has gone, the veins have become moist and the reward is confirmed, Allah willing.

[Dawood, al-Nasaai in al-Kubra, ibn al-Sunee and others. Declared hasan by scholars such as al-Hilaali. See al-Hilaali vol. 1, p. 493.]



16.Committing a Sin

Perform wudu and then perform two Rak'ah, and finally ask Allah for forgiveness. Surely he will be forgiven. [Dawud 2/86, At-Tirmidhi 2/257]



17.Loving Another

When one brother loves another for the sake of Allah, swt, he should inform him of that by saying,

'Innee 'uhibbuka fee-laah.

"I love you for the sake of Allah"


His brother's response should be,

'ahabbaka-lladhee 'ahbabtanee lah(u)

"May the One for whose sake you love me love you."

[Abu Dawud. According to al-Albani, this hadith is sahih. See al-Albani, Sahih Sunan Abi Dawood, vol. 3, pl. 965]



18.Stricken by Setback or if Something Displeasing Happens to a Person

Qaddara-llaahu wa ma shaa'a fa'al(a).

What Allah decreed and what He wishes will be done. [Muslim 4/2052]

"And avoid using the word, "if," for that opens the door for the acts of Satan."
[Recorded by ibn al-Sunee. According to al-Salafi, this hadith is sahih. See al-Salafi, p. 126.]



19.Last Words Before Dying

La ilaha illallahu.

There is no deity but Allah. [Dawud 3/190]



20.When the Wind Blows

Allahumma inni as'aluka khairaha, wa a'udhu bika min sharriha.

Oh Allah, I ask you for the good of it and seek refuge in You against its evil. [Dawud 4/326, Ibn Majah 2/1228, See also Al-Albani]



21.When Hearing Thunder
Subhanalladhi yusabbihur ra'du bi hamdihi wal malaa'ikatu min kheefatihi.

Glory to Him whom thunder and angels magnify with their praise, who are before Him awestruck. [Malik, Al-Muwatta' 2/992]



22.Before Marital Relations

Bismillah. Allahumma jannibnash shaitaana, wa jannibish shaitaana ma razaqtana.

By the Name of Allah. Oh Allah, cause the shaytaan to pass us by and cause the devil to pass by that which You provide for us [Bukhari 6/141, Muslim 2/1028]


23.After Farz Namaz

Allah huma a'ni Ala zikri ka wa shukrika, wa husna ibadatika

O Allah Help me Glorify You, and to thank you and to have excellence in Your Worship

24.Guidance

Allhumma ini asalukal huda, wa takwa, wal a'afa, wal ghana

O Allah I ask you the guidance, piety, abstinenece and rich (of self).

Muslim

25.Mercy

Allahumma ghrilli, war hamni, wa a'fini, wa zukni

O Allah Forgive me, have mercy upon me, guide me, exempt me, and provide me.

Moslim

26.Heart to Allah's obedience

Allahom'a mossar'ef al qoloob sar'eff qolobana ala ta'ateka

O Allah Who trun the hearts away, turn our hearts away to your obedience

Moslem

27.Refuge in Allah Against Trouble of trial

Allhumma inni a'uzubika min jahdil bala i, wa darakishika i,wa soo il qadha i, wa shama tatil a'ada

O Allah grant mein refuge against trouble of Trial, bottom of misery, misrule, and disappointing for enemies

28.Affairs of this world of after

Allahumma assl'ih li deen yallazy huwa 'issmatu amri, wa assl'ih li duniya yallati fi ma'ashi, wa assl'ih li akhira tillati fi ma'ddi, waj'alil hayata ziyadatan li fi kulli khair, waj'alil mawta rahtan li min kulli shar'in

O Allah make my religion easy for me by virtue of which my affairs are protected, set right for me my world where my life exists, make good for me my Hereafter which is my resort to which I have to return, and make my life prone to perform all types of good, and make death a comfort for me from every evil

Moslem

29.Straight Path

Allahumma ahdiny wa sad'didny

O Allah direct me to the Right Path and make me adhere to the Straight Path

Allahumma inni as'aluk alhuda was Alsadad

I beg You for guidance and uprightness

Moslem

30.Protection

Allahumma inni a'uzu bika minal ajzi wal kasali, wal jubni wal harami, wl bukhli, wa a'uzu bika min azabil qabri, wa a'uzu bika min fitnatil mahya wal mamaat

O Allah I seek refuge in You from helplessness, indolence, cowardice, senility, and miserliness, and I seek Your protection against the torment of the Grave and the trails of life and death

Moslem

31.Supplication in Salat

Allahumma innizalamtu nafsi zulman kathiran, wa la yaghfirulal Zonoba illa Anta, faghfirli maghfiratan min indika warhamni innaka Antal Ghaffoor Al Raheem

O Allah I have considerably wronged myself. There is none to forgive the sins but You. So grant me Pardon and have mercy on me . You are the Most Forgiving, and the Most Compassionate

Al Bokhary and Moslem

32.Asking Forgivness

Allhumma aghfir li khateeaty, wajahli, wa issrafy fi amry, wa ma Anta alamu bihi minni. Allahumma aghfir li jiddy wa hazli wa khataey wa amdi, wa kullu zalika indi. Allahumma aghfirli ma qadamtu wa ma akhartu, wa ma asrartu, wa ma alantu, wa ma Anta alamu bihi minni. Antal Muqaddimu, wa Antal Mo'akhkhir, wa Anta 'ala kulli shai in Qadir

O Allah Forgive my errors, ignorance and immoderation in my affairs. You are better aware of my faults than myself. O Allah Forgive my faults which I commited in seriousness or in fun deliberately or inadvertently. O Allah Grant me pardon for those sins which I committed in the past and I amy commit in future, which I committed in privacy or in public and all those sins of which You are better aware than me. You Alone can send whomever You will to Paradise, and You Alone can send whomever YOU will to Hell and You are Omnipotent.

Rated Saheeh

33.Evil what we have done

Allahumma inni a'uzubika min shar'y ma'amiltu, wa min shar'y ma lam amal

O Allah I seek refuge in You from the evil of that which I have done and the evil of that which I have not done.

Moslem

34.Favours of Allah

Allahumma inni a'uzu bika min zawaly ni'ematika, wa tahawwuly a'feytika, wa fuje'ati niqmatika, wa jamee'e sakhatika

O Allah I seek refuge in You against the declining of Your Favours, passing of safety, and suddenness of Your punishment

Moslem

Allahumma inni a'uzu bika minal ajzi wal kasali wal bukhli wal harami, wa azabil Qabri. Allahumma ati nafsi taqwaha wa zakkiha Anta khairu man zakkaha, Anta wali yuha wa mawlaha. Allahumma inni auzu bika min elm la yanfau wa min qalbin la yakhshau, wa min nafsin la tashbau, wa min sawatan la yustajabu laha

O Allah I seek refuge in You from the inability (to do good), indolence, cowardice, miserliness, decrepitude and torment of the grave. O Allah Grant me the sense of piety and purify my soul as You are the Best to purify it. You are its Guardian and its Protecting Friend. O Allah I seek refuge in You from the knowledge which is not beneficial, and from a heart which does not fear(You) and from desire which is not satisfied, and from prayer which is not answered.

Moslem

Allahumma laka aslamtu, wa bika amantu, wa alaika tawakaltu, wa ilaika anabtu, wa bika khsamtu, wa ilaika hakamtu. Faghfir li ma qaddamtu wa ma akh khartu, wa ma asrartu wa ma alantu, Antal Muqaddimu, wa Antal Muakkhiru La ilaha illa Anta

O Allah to You I submit in You I affirm my faith, in You I repose my trust, to You I trun in repentance and with Your Help I contend my adversaries and from You I seek Judgement. O Allah Grant me forgiveness for the faults which I made in past and those ones I may commit in future, those which I committed secretly or openly. You Alone send whomever You will to Paradise, and YOu Alone send whomever You will to Hell.There is none worthy of worship except You

Narrated by Ibn Abass R.A

35.Richness and Poverty

Allahumma inni a'uzu bika min fitna tinnari wa azaabin naari, wa min sharral ghina wal faqar

O Allah I ask you refuge of the tomb trail and the fire punishment and the rich and poverty

Aby Dawood

36.Desire

Allahumma inni a'uzubika min munkaratil ikhlaaqi wal a'mali, wal ahwa

O Allah I ask you refuge of bad morals, deeds and desires

Termezey

Allahumma inni a'uzu bika min sharri samei wa min sharri bassary wa min sharri lissany wa min sharri qalby wa min sharri maniey

O Allah I ask you refuge of the evil of my listening, my sight, my tongue, my heart, and my sperm.

Aby Dawood and Termezey

37.Refuge from Disease

Allahumma inni a'uzu bika minal barasi wal jununi wa juzami wassiyil asqaam

O Allah I ask you refuge of leprosy, craziness, and the worst diseases.

Misc

Allahumma inni a'uzu bika min juu'i fa innahu bissa daj'i wa a'uzu bika minal khayanati, fa innaha b sa til bitana

O Allah I ask you refuge of hunger, that is the worst bedfellow. I ask you refuge of treason, that is the worst lining

Aby Dawood


Allahummak fini bi halalika an haramika, aghnini bi fadhlika amma siwaak

O Allah Suffice me from Your allowance instead of Your ill gotten and from Your Favour no one else make me rich

Termezey


Allahumma Alhamni rushdi wa a'izni min sharri nafsi

O Allah Give me my reason, and protect me against my evil


Ask for Soundness in this life and Hereafter

Allahumma inni asalukal afiyata fid duniya wal akhira

O Allah grant me soundness in this lifetime and Hereafter

38.Most Supplication that the Messenger saas used to make

Ya Mukallibal Qulubi sabbit Qalbi A'la dinnik

O who turn the hearts fix my heart on Your religion

Termezey


39.Love for Allah

The Messenger of Allah saas taught us the Dua of Hazrat Dawood Alaisalam

Allahumma inni asaluka hubba, wa hubba man yu hibbika, wal a'malal lazi yu ballighuni hubba. Allahumma aj'al hubba ahabba ilai min nafsi wa ahli wa min maa i wal bard

O Allah Make Your Love in me better than myself, my family and better than the cold water

Termezey
